Transaction 629550911c27a76623f75d118bbd045c13fbe17dd5d79ed0bafdf4be5fc9c951
1 Input
1 Output
-
629550911c27a76623f75d118bbd045c13fbe17dd5d79ed0bafdf4be5fc9c951:0
- value
- 876620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a1c29b6c105adcca35a9bdbca909769b91c1602a OP_EQUAL
- address
- 3GSKqy6j5DHiVctGMtbBsqxXHtVcwyRYGW